Background
In the industrial production of environmental protection engineering equipment, need be 0.05mm with thickness, the stainless steel band of width 5mm be the heliciform winding on the quartz capsule external surface of external diameter 55mm, require that initial angle and pitch precision are higher, and manual rotatory wire winding frock needs the manual hand to hold the handle and twine its rotation.
At present, most functions of the existing manual winding devices are single, winding needs to be stopped when workers have a rest in the winding process, rebounding may occur when the winding devices are stopped, and the former part of work becomes useless, time and labor are wasted. Therefore, the manual rotary wire winding tool for the beam suspension is improved.

When the device works, a material to be processed is aligned to a wire winding needle 14, a crank 7 is rotated to drive a screw 6 to rotate, so that the wire winding needle 14 is driven to rotate, the material to be processed is wound, when a rest is needed in the middle, a fixing band 18 can be inserted into a fixing ring 17 to complete fixing, a first fixing nut 9 is arranged on the surface of the screw 6, the first fixing nut and the screw 6 are connected through threads, the first fixing nut 9 is arranged on the surface of the screw 6 to realize the fixing of the screw 6, a base 13 is arranged at one end of the fixing plate 12, the base 13 and the fixing plate 12 are fixed through screws, a base 13 is arranged at one end of the fixing plate 12 to realize the fixing of the wire winding needle 14, a fixing plate 12 is arranged at one end of the screw 6, the fixing plate 12 and the screw 6 are fixed through welding, a fixing plate 12 is arranged at one end of the screw 6 to realize the fixing of the base 13, and a wire winding needle 14 is arranged at one end of the base 13, the wire winding needles 14 are uniformly arranged on the surface of the base 13, one end of the fixing rod 3 is provided with a limiting plate 15, and the wire winding needles 14 are arranged at one end of the base 13, so that the wire winding function of the equipment is realized.
